What we automate
Inbound call answering
The voice agent answers every call in under two rings, identifies itself as your business, and handles the conversation from greeting to resolution.
Appointment booking
Callers can book, reschedule, or cancel appointments directly through the voice agent — synced to your calendar in real time, no human required.
Lead qualification
The agent asks your qualifying questions, captures the caller's contact information and service interest, and scores the lead before passing it to your team.
After-hours coverage
Calls that come in at 8pm on a Friday get the same quality response as Monday morning calls. No after-hours answering service fees.
FAQ handling
Pricing, hours, service area, process questions — the voice agent handles your most common inbound questions so your team is not answering the same calls all day.
Overflow routing
When your team is on a call or unavailable, the voice agent picks up the overflow and either handles it fully or takes a message with structured lead data for callback.

Does the voice agent sound robotic?
Modern AI voice agents use natural-sounding speech synthesis that most callers cannot distinguish from a human. The agent speaks in a natural conversational tone, pauses appropriately, and handles interruptions. We configure the voice, name, and personality to match your brand.
What happens when a caller has a complex question the agent cannot handle?
The agent is configured with a graceful handoff for edge cases — it can transfer the call to a live team member, offer a callback, or take a detailed message depending on your preference. It never leaves a caller stranded.
Which calendar and booking systems does it integrate with?
We integrate with Google Calendar, Outlook Calendar, Calendly, Acuity, and most major scheduling platforms. Bookings appear in your calendar in real time the moment the caller confirms.
Can it handle multiple calls at the same time?
Yes. Unlike a human receptionist, the voice agent handles unlimited concurrent calls — so a busy period or a marketing campaign that drives call volume does not create a bottleneck.
What industries use voice agents most effectively?
Home services (HVAC, plumbing, roofing, landscaping), medical and dental practices, legal and accounting firms, real estate, and any service business where the phone is a primary sales channel. If you are losing revenue to missed or slow-answered calls, a voice agent solves it.
